Himeji Castle Visitor Numbers Hit Record High as Ticket Prices for Foreign Tourists May Quadruple

Reported 8 months ago

According to a report from Yomiuri Shimbun on June 17, 2024, the mayor of Himeji City, Hidetai Kiyomoto, revealed plans to quadruple ticket prices for foreign tourists visiting Himeji Castle, potentially raising the price from $7 to $30 per person. The increased revenue from the ticket price hike is intended to address issues caused by excessive tourism and fund the upcoming 10th-anniversary renovations of the castle in 2025. With a record 1.48 million visitors in 2023, including 450,000 foreign tourists, Himeji Castle is experiencing a surge in popularity. This move aligns with various regions in Japan implementing measures to manage overtourism, such as Tokyo's dual pricing in restaurants and considerations of accommodation taxes in Hokkaido, Miyagi Prefecture, and Chiba Prefecture.

Home Fire Safety: Taipei City Fire Department Reminds 5 Do's and 1 Don't for Electrical Use

Reported 8 months ago

According to the Taipei City Fire Department, over 70% of residential buildings in Taipei City are over 30 years old, raising concerns about potential fire hazards. Among the common causes of fires in these buildings, electrical factors consistently rank high. To prevent electrical fires, it is essential to adhere to the '5 Do's and 1 Don't' principle: avoid overloading circuits, refrain from bundling or damaging electrical wires, ensure plugs are not moist or damaged, unplug devices when not in use, maintain a safe distance from flammable materials when using heat-generating appliances, and only use electrical appliances with safety certification labels. Additionally, installing residential fire alarms is recommended for early detection of fires. People in Taipei City can obtain one alarm per household from their local fire brigade.

China Retaliates by Initiating Anti-Dumping Investigation on EU Pork

Reported 8 months ago

On June 17, 2024, China retaliated against the EU's tariffs on Chinese electric cars by launching an anti-dumping investigation on EU-origin pork and pork products. The investigation follows the EU's decision to impose tariffs on Chinese electric vehicles. The EU does not express concern about China's anti-dumping probe, while Spain's Economy Minister Carlos Cuerpo emphasizes cooperation with the EU to avoid a trade war with China. China's punitive measures could significantly impact the EU's pork industry, particularly if China halts imports of European pork products like pig ears, noses, and feet, which have limited demand in Europe. While this may severely affect European pork farmers, the overall trade impact between China and the EU remains limited, as pork accounts for a small portion of China's imports from the EU.
